Male Pattern Hair Loss – How and why does it happen?

Male pattern hair loss is also know as alopecia and is characterized by a receding hairline on the top of the head. Hair loss can occur due to various reasons in males; when it occurs due to hormonal changes or is hereditary in nature, it is known as androgenetic alopecia or simply balding.

Mostly, male pattern hair loss is inherited and such people have increased sensitivity to the hormonal compound dihydrotestosterone or DHT which is a derivative of the male sex hormone, testosterone. DHT is known to shorten the hair cycle phase which can lead to miniaturization of the hair follicles which in turn can lead to the growth of finer hairs. Since the new hair that is grown is not strong enough, they tend to break easily leading to hair loss.

Male pattern hair loss can have deep seated and serious psychological impact on most males leading to low self esteem, depression, low confidence, shying away from social gatherings and a feeling of unattractiveness. This is largely caused by the attitude of the society to such people giving out a feeling that bald men are less attractive and successful than men with good hair.

Today, there are various treatments for male pattern hair loss which can range from cosmetics to transplants to medications. There are doctors who specialize in the treatment of hair loss and are known as trichologists. Some of the hair loss treatment options include hair replacement or transplantation, cosmetic solutions, hair bonding, Minoxidil solution and medications like Finasteride.
